典型的教育约束处理实例

时间:2011-02-14 15:31:48

标签: artificial-intelligence constraint-programming

我正在写一门描述人工智能主题的课程。目前我正在研究“约束处理”部分。为了说明约束处理,我想包括一个简单的例子。这个例子应该具有以下特质:

  • 我想绘制一个OR树,因此该示例不能包含那么多变量和选项
  • 说明节点一致性,回溯,回跳,加标记,弱松弛和弧一致性。 (这些例子应该说明这些方法是有意义的,并为约束处理增加了一些价值)。
  • 易于理解和代表。 (不是两页长的约束)。

我浏览网页已有一段时间了,但现在所有的例子都不符合这些品质。 (我也试图简化现有问题)。

是否有任何典型的例子来说明这些方法/技巧?给出两个不同的例子并在这两个例子之间分配技术也不是问题。

1 个答案:

答案 0 :(得分:1)

旅游锦标赛问题可能符合您的一些要求。它很难NP并且没有太多变量和选项:

enter image description here